I think you're confused by the definition of public space. Public space is property owned by the government. A liberal would support no religious symbols in a court house because that's public property owned by the government. Most airports are private property, not owned by the government. The same applies to universities. That's why liberals are silent when Christians make an issue about these "public" accomodations for other religions. The airports and universities are not public in the same sense that court houses are public.
